
首先使用條形碼字體將序列號轉換為條形碼,通過設置字體并輸入公式實現;其次利用TBarCode等插件插入高精度條形碼對象,支持多種編碼標準;最后可通過VBA宏自動批量生成條形碼圖像。
如果您需要在Excel中為大量數據生成帶有唯一序列號的條形碼,可以通過結合公式與條形碼字體實現高效批量處理。此方法適用于商品管理、資產編號等場景。
本文運行環境:DellXPS13,Windows11
一、使用條形碼字體批量生成
通過安裝專用條形碼字體(如Code128或C39),將包含序列號的單元格內容轉換為可視條形碼。該方式無需額外插件,操作簡單且兼容性強。
1、在Excel中輸入序列號數據,例如A列從A1開始依次填寫“001”、“002”、“003”等。
2、選中需要顯示條形碼的B列單元格區域,設置字體為Code128或Free3of9。
3、在B1單元格輸入公式=A1,回車后復制該公式至其他行以匹配所有序列號。
4、調整B列單元格的高度和寬度,確保條形碼完整顯示。
二、利用第三方插件生成高精度條形碼
通過安裝Excel條形碼插件(如TBarCode或BarcodeAdd-InforExcel),可直接插入專業級條形碼對象,并支持多種編碼標準。
1、下載并安裝TBarCodeXL插件,重啟Excel程序。
2、在Excel中打開數據表,定位到需插入條形碼的單元格,點擊插件選項卡中的“InsertBarcode”按鈕。
三、通過VBA宏自動創建條形碼圖像
利用VBA調用系統組件或嵌入字體渲染邏輯,可在不依賴外部工具的前提下自動生成條形碼圖像并插入工作表。
1、按Alt+F11打開VBA器,插入新模塊。
2、粘貼以下代碼:
SubGenerateBarcode()DimiAsIntegerFori=1To100Cells(i,2).Value=Cells(i,1).ValueCells(i,2).Font.Name="Code128"NextiEndSub
3、關閉器返回Excel,運行宏“GenerateBarcode”,系統將自動將A列前100行的序列號轉換為B列的條形碼格式。
以上就是Excel如何批量生成帶序列號的條形碼_Excel條形碼批量生成方法的詳細內容,!

